    hey biglad and congrats on the new house. i'll never forget the feeling i had when i first got my own place.

    best piece of advice i can give you is think on what you really need to get settled int eh house then buy the other things as and when you can afford them. when i moved in all i had was a bed, chest of drawers, futon (used as a sofa) and a set of shelves. so long as you have someplace to sleep, sit and somethign to provide you with food you are sorted, the rest can wait! but i do know how hard it is to not go nuts, thats why i'm here now!
